Abstract

The invention relates to a scraped surface heat exchanger ( 100 ) comprising a heat exchanging wall ( 20 ) having an cylindrical inner surface ( 21 ) with a radius (R+δ), a shaft ( 10 ) being rotatable mounted inside of and concentrically to the inner surface ( 21 ) of the heat exchanging wall ( 20 ) and having at least one gap portion ( 10 A) with an outer surface ( 11 ) and a radius (R), and at least one scraping member ( 40 ) supported by the shaft ( 10 ) and extending to the inner surface ( 21 ) of the heat exchanger wall ( 20 ), characterized in that the at least one or che gap portions ( 10 A) with an outer surface ( 11 ) and a radius (R) extend over at least 60% of the circumference of the shaft ( 10 ).

Claims (25)

1. A scraped surface heat exchanger comprising:

a heat exchanging wall having a cylindrical inner surface with a radius (R+δ);

a shaft being rotatable mounted inside of and concentrically to the inner surface of the heat exchanging wall and having at least one gap portion with an outer surface and a radius (R); and

at least one scraping member supported by the shaft and extending to the inner surface of the heat exchanger wall,

wherein the shear rate (D= 1/30*π*n*R/δ) is less than 600/s given a shaft speed of n.

2. The scraped surface heat exchanger of claim 1 , wherein in the ratio of the radius of the at least one gap portion to the gap between the inner surface of the heat exchanger wall and the outer surface of the at least one gap portion is at least 6.

3. The scraped surface heat exchanger according to claim 1 , wherein the gap (δ) between the inner surface of the heat exchanger wall and the outer surface of the at least one gap portion is less than 15 mm.

4. The scraped surface heat exchanger according to claim 1 , wherein the inner surface of the heat exchanger wall comprises a protective layer.

5. The scraped surface heat exchanger according to claim 1 , wherein the at least one or the gap portions with an outer surface and a radius (R) extend over at least 60% of the circumference of the shaft.

6. The scraped surface heat exchanger according to claim 1 , wherein the scraped surface heat exchanger is operated with a speed of the shaft of less than 900 RPM.

7. The scraped surface heat exchanger according to claim 1 , wherein the ratio (R/((R+δ)−R)) of the radius (R) of the at least one gap portion to the gap (δ) between the inner surface of the heat exchanger wall and the outer surface of the at least one gap portion is at least 7.

8. The scraped surface heat exchanger according to claim 1 , wherein the gap (δ) between the inner surface of the heat exchanger wall and the outer surface of the at least one gap portion is less than 13 mm.

9. The scraped surface heat exchanger of claim 1 , wherein the at least one of the gap portions with an outer surface and a radius (R) extend over at least 70% of the circumference of the shaft.

10. The scraped surface heat exchanger according to claim 1 , wherein the inner surface of the heat exchanger wall is hard chromed.

11. The scraped surface heat exchanger according to claim 1 , wherein the shear rate (D=v(R)/δ= 1/30*π*n*R/δ) is less than 500/s.

12. The scraped surface heat exchanger according to claim 1 , wherein the scraped surface heat exchanger is operated with a speed of the shaft of less than 800 RPM.

13. The scraped surface heat exchanger according to claim 1 , wherein the shaft comprises at least two gap portions with an outer surface and a radius.

14. The scraped surface heat exchanger of claim 13 , wherein the at least two gap portions are arranged symmetrical with respect to the axis of rotation.

15. The scraped surface heat exchanger of claim 13 , wherein the shaft comprises cut-off portions each being arranged between two gap portions.

16. The scraped surface heat exchanger of claim 15 , wherein one scraping member is arranged at one cut-off portion.

17. The scraped surface heat exchanger according to claim 1 , wherein the at least one scraping member comprises a scraping blade made of plastic.

18. The scraped surface heat exchanger according to claim 1 , wherein the heat exchanging wall is made of stainless steel that is hard chromed at its inner surface.

19. The scraped surface heat exchanger according to claim 1 , wherein the at least one scraping member is pivotally mounted at the shaft.

20. The scraped surface heat exchanger according to claim 1 , wherein the shaft comprises a recess connected to passages for passing a cooling fluid through the recess.

21. The scraped surface heat exchanger according to claim 1 , further comprising an outer wall defining a heat exchanger fluid room between its inner surface and the outer surface of the heat exchanging wall.
